    I've been back and forth as to who I think we should draft with our first pick, and I think I've finally settled. I've seen all the mocks, read the board, watched videos and have been glued to NFL Network so I feel I've done my due diligence; at least as much as an armchair quarterback can be expected to do.

    Based on our free agent acquisitions I feel this is a luxury pick in a way, I mean our biggest weakness have been addressed the way the FO felt was best... for better or for worse. The interior O-line has been beefed up, especially at guard and safety has been addressed with two guys who could start. We also got bigger up the middle with two huge bodies.

    The one area of weakness I see is at corner. Honestly McCourtey is, ideally, a #2 corner on just about any other team. Verner wouldn't be a starter on most teams as I see it, but we would clearly see the field in sub packages. This leads me to believe that corner is where we should go with our first pick. Not only is it a clear area of need but drafting 10th we should have a shot at the 2nd best corner in the draft or perhaps the top corner.

    I do feel that Geno Smith will not be a top 10 pick, I also think that Milliner will be taken in the top 9, so that leaves us with a few top guys:

    Desmond Trufant
    Xavier Rhodes
    Jonathan Banks
    Jamar Taylor

    and so on...

    Most, including myself don't see Banks or Taylor being first round picks, however Taylor may sneak into the bottom. This leaves me with Desmond Trufant and Xavier Rhodes. To me the answer is clear, with the 10th pick we should draft Xavier Rhodes, here's why.

    The guy is a day one starter at corner, which would push Verner to slot and sub packages with is best for the defense anyway. I really like his size to be able to cover the Jimmy Grahams and Gronks of the league... 6'2", 217 and runs 4.4, that is perfect. The fact that he is a physical player really sets him up to cover tight ends and to possibly play safety which, lets be honest, despite the new additions would be a upgrade.

    So Rhodes offers us and upgrade at corner, the ability to play different coverages and may develop into an incredible safety, which personally I think may be his best position on the NFL.
